Congratulations to both Girls' and Boys' Cross Country teams for their performances at the State Championship today!
🏃♀️The girls placed 5th overall as a team, with Maya York and Ashlyn Smith finishing 6th and 14th respectively to claim All-State honors as individuals.
🏃♂️The boys placed 7th as a team, with Gabe Voelker and Carter Younger finishing 10th and 15th respectively to claim All-State honors as individuals. Andres Kemper also finished 31st, just one spot shy of qualifying for All-State.
What a fantastic season for both teams, capped off by another impressive showing in Columbia!

Conference Champs and District Runners Up! ⚽
The boys gave Rockhurst everything they could handle. They took the undefeated Hawklets to extra time but, with a 3-2 loss, the Boys' Soccer season has come to an end. After a 5-5 start, the team rallied to win 10 of their last 12 games and come within minutes of punching their ticket to the State Tournament.
What an incredible season! 💛🐾🖤

What a season it was!
Girls' Golf 🏌️♀️ competed at the State Tournament and finished 6th as a team - one of the best team finishes in school history. Addie Swan's T23 and Sam Larkins' T30 finishes led the way. McKenna Raymond T56, Celia Barber T72, and Ansley Harper T88 also competed in the two day tournament at Silo Ridge Golf Course in Bolivar, MO and had very impressive seasons.
Congratulations ladies!! ⛳️
